Output 723fa52433ad6089d818e84b29789eaa7d6650dc1afb6c644df8dec4a2704788:1

value
23500354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ad0ee06366c4ed6f7699e0f13839ca2c730929b0 OP_EQUAL
address
MPgCxFmGUu7K2DxhBJzvP8548ifm4FQn7n
transaction
723fa52433ad6089d818e84b29789eaa7d6650dc1afb6c644df8dec4a2704788
spent
true